The Barn is one of three cottages in a u-shaped farm steading conversion in the Highlands of Scotland. It's rural but situated close enough to Inverness and Nairn to enjoy town life too. After a days' exploring return to the Barn to relax and unwind. The Barn sleeps up to 6 and provides comfortable accommodation and an ideal location to tour the Highlands - Loch Ness, Aviemore & the Cairngorm Mountains, Dolphin Spotting, superb golf, Inverness (10 miles) and Nairn (6 miles). Culloden Battlefield, Cawdor Castle and Fort George nearby.

What an amazing place to stay. We visited at the beginning of August and I have to stay despite our difficulties (nothing to do with the accommodation), we still had the most fantastic time. Barbara is a wonderfully helpful host, who endeavoured to assist us in any way she could; from my being dense and not being able to work the extractor fan, to supporting us when our beloved family car decided the 7 hour drive up was too much for her. The Barn was cleaned to the highest standard and had everything we could have wanted in terms of facilities and accoutrements. The table and chairs in the garden area was lovely for an early morning breakfast with the company of the local small birds. The kitchen was fully equipped, right down to ice in the ice cube tray, washing up liquid and clingfilm and a gravy boat! All of the things you would usually expect to have to buy yourself on a self catering holiday in terms of washing clothes and dishwasher tablets were there for you to use. The living room is a lovely size, and I am only sad that we weren't able to use the log fire. For once we didn't have poor weather and so putting the fire on would have been a total waste even if we all were desperate to. The downstairs toilet/shower room was lovely. Super clean and very handy. My 16 year old daughter had the downstairs twin room and was more than comfortable. Upstairs the double room had plenty of space and storage, and the views were great. the blinds on the Velux window really cut out the light allowing you to sleep in. The upstairs bathroom was large with a comfortable bath. My 18 year old son had the upstairs twin room, and again had plenty of space and was very happy with the room. I have one word of caution for anyone that does not know the area and it is more to do with the location than the cottage itself. You must make sure you have what you need in terms of groceries. Unless you are willing to hop in the car if you run out of milk, or are happy to take nice long walk, you need to make sure you are organised as there isn't a local shop you can 'nip' to by foot. For me this wasn't an issue as I had a young man that loved an evening stroll to the somewhat nearby Tornagrain and it was one of the reasons we really enjoyed the location - so nice and quite we even saw a deer in the field opposite the cottage early one morning. Just make sure you do your homework in terms of what you need, otherwise you will most likely need to take a trip in the car to get anything you run out of. Nairn is very close by which has fantastic beaches (be warned - the traffic can build up if you head through during rush hour) a large Sainsbury's, McDonald's and Home Bargains. You are also very close to Fort George, which is a great place for a visit with a couple of nice cafes. I am looking forward to booking in to The Barn again hopefully for next year!

How to get there
BY ROAD From the south (A9) As you approach Inverness follow signs for A96 Aberdeen road. Approximately 10 miles along this road you will see signs for Croy and Cawdor. There is also a restaurant. Turn right then next right for Croy. We are the first farm/house on the left. From the east (A96) Approximately 6 miles from Nairn you will see signs for Croy and Cawdor. There is also a restaurant. Turn left then next right for Croy. We are the first farm/house on the left. From the airport Located 2.6 miles from the airport, approximately 5 minutes by car. From the airport follow signs for Aberdeen (A96). Turn right at the junction for Croy/Cawdor. Turn right again for Croy. We are the first farm/house on the left. BY AIR to Inverness Airport Flights into Inverness by Flybe, Easyjet, and Lufthansa. We are approximately 10 minutes/4 miles from the airport. BY RAIL nearest stations are in Nairn and Inverness. BY BUS nearest bus stations are in Nairn and Inverness. The No. 10 will drop you off on the A96. Please note a car is advised for touring the area.
